Download a completed personal data export.
GET
/api/user/data-export/{id}/download
Code sample: Shell / cURL
curl --request GET \ --url https://auth.example.com/api/user/data-export/example/download \ --header 'Authorization: Bearer <token>'Downloads the completed export owned by the authenticated user as JSON or CSV. The endpoint returns not_ready until asynchronous exports complete and expired when the export is no longer available.
